The food industry is the largest and most critical segment within the Bulk Packer Market. Bulk packing in this sector typically involves packaging large quantities of food products such as grains, sugar, flour, nuts, oils, dairy products, and beverages. These packers are instrumental in ensuring food safety, maintaining hygiene standards, and reducing wastage through efficient packaging. With the increasing demand for ready-to-eat meals, convenience foods, and sustainable packaging, the food industry continues to drive innovations in bulk packaging solutions. Packaging materials like biodegradable plastics and eco-friendly bags are gaining prominence as part of the growing trend toward sustainability in the food industry.

The "Others" segment in the Bulk Packer Market encompasses industries outside the food sector that require large-scale packaging solutions. This includes industries such as chemicals, pharmaceuticals, agriculture, and construction. In the chemical industry, bulk packing solutions are used to store and transport various chemicals like fertilizers, paints, and industrial solvents, ensuring safe and reliable containment. Similarly, the pharmaceutical industry relies on bulk packers for packaging over-the-counter medications, vitamins, and other bulk pharmaceutical products. Packaging in these sectors demands high precision, reliability, and compliance with safety and regulatory standards.
In agriculture, bulk packers are essential for the efficient packaging of seeds, fertilizers, and other agricultural products. They provide solutions that help to maintain the quality and integrity of agricultural goods during storage and transport. The construction industry also utilizes bulk packers for materials such as cement, sand, and other bulk goods. 1. What is the bulk packing process?
Bulk packing involves the packaging of large quantities of products into large containers or packages, typically used for industrial purposes, to facilitate transportation and storage.
2. How does the bulk packing market differ between food and non-food industries?
In the food industry, bulk packing focuses on maintaining freshness and safety, while non-food industries prioritize material handling, storage, and regulatory compliance.
3. What are the most commonly used materials in bulk packaging?
The most common materials include plastic, cardboard, paper, and biodegradable options, depending on the product type and industry requirements.
